Output 684687b8f15ba304a785e38609427db00e52cdef8885b19bd49a17f282d24e65:0

value
52000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baf0387af7b9112b3ef560797450cf946f7e49f OP_EQUAL
address
3MibZj45A4CEzDdXUpS68RxAscqPi2q2eS
transaction
684687b8f15ba304a785e38609427db00e52cdef8885b19bd49a17f282d24e65
spent
true